| |
|
|
| | Как лучше делать ссылки, какие лучше пути абсолютные или относительные?
Конкретнее - какой механизм можно использовать например у меня на ЛОКАЛКЕ
Верхнее меню которое одинаковое для всех страниц, если его сделать ОТНОСИТЕЛЬНЫМИ ССЫЛКАМИ, то на каждой странице ведь будут разные пути! А ЕСЛИ СДЕЛАТЬ АБСОЛЮТНЫЙ ПУТЬ от корня, ТО ПРИ ПЕРЕНОСЕ ДОПУСТИМ НА ДРУГОЙ ХОСТ ОНИ УЖЕ БУДУТ
неправильными! Как поступить??? | |
| |
|
|
| |
|
|
| |
для: ШИМ
(01.04.2007 в 17:58)
| | | только относительные | |
| |
|
|
| |
|
|
| |
для: Leon_uman
(01.04.2007 в 19:01)
| | | Ну как относительные?
У меня ОДНО МЕНЮ ДЛЯ всего сайта - к примеру
include "top.php";
.......
cодержимое,
страницы меняются
.......
top.php
<a href=index.php>на главную
|
если я в тойже папке нахожусь то она работает!
но если я уже в другой папке например
catalog/show.php
то эта ссылка никак на главную не приведет, тогда путь будет ../index.php.
есть вариант только прописывать переменные на каждой странице и подставлять их в ссылку но так не хочеться, может по другому както? | |
| |
|
|
| |
|
|
| |
для: ШИМ
(01.04.2007 в 22:33)
| | | Ну СПЕЦИАЛИСТЫ, каким образом в сайтах если одно и то же меню, ссылки прописываются?
И чтобы не приходилось менять их при переносе на другой хост? | |
| |
|
|
| |
|
|
| |
для: ШИМ
(01.04.2007 в 17:58)
| | | Вы можете указывать ссылки от корня сайта, если они будут начинаться со слеша
| |
| |
|
|
| |
|
|
| |
для: cheops
(02.04.2007 в 12:41)
| | | Т.Е. примерно так
<a href=".$_SERVER['doc_root']."/dir.index.php"> ПЕРЕЙТИ </a> | |
| |
|
|
| |
|
|
| |
для: ШИМ
(02.04.2007 в 12:52)
| | | Можно вообще вот так поступить
<a href=/dir/index.php"> ПЕРЕЙТИ </a>
|
Браузер сам подставит доменное имя, но отсчёт будет вестись от корня - т.е. путь будет абсолютный. | |
| |
|
|
| |
|
|
| |
для: cheops
(02.04.2007 в 12:55)
| | | . | |
| |
|
|